This thread has been a lifesaver - thank you all! As someone else mentioned, grandparents not being able to see pictures of the grandkids was resulting in countless follow-ups about why they couldn't see the pictures. This morning I was sick enough of it to actually dig into the behavior further. From everything I've found, Apple never formally acknowledged this issue, so I spent 2+ hours jumping through pointless hoops to find out none of the usual suspects (need to reconnect, resync, update permissions, etc) were part of the resolution. Only after I isolated the behavior of this being an issue with uploads of portrait mode photos to a shared album could I make any headway in resolving. Thankfully, isolating the portrait mode portion of the behavior led me here and y'all did the rest of the heavy lifting for me.
 
Do we need to re-add the old portrait photos that were greyed out?
Based on my experience and everything I have been able to find, yes. The good news is this issue will be isolated to portrait mode uploads to a shared album while using the 15.1 iOS.

To simplify the recovery process, I found that the same portrait mode photos that shared album users weren't able to see also weren't visible on my MacBook Pro. A quick cross-reference of the greyed-out photos from my MacBooks against the pictures I could see on my phone allowed me to quickly re-upload. Naturally, there's more than one way to fully resolve the issue. This approach just helped me save time and be self-sufficient in fully resolving the issue, as the interactions with grandparents (shared album viewers) were not helping matters.

Update: I spoke to Apple support who acknowledged the known issue. They said that upgrading all devices to the latest OS should fix but since it didn't for me, they asked I turn off shared albums, wait 10mins, reboot and turn shared albums back on (same advice for all iOS and MacOS devices).

I've done that and I can now share portrait mode pictures OK but the previous images haven't recovered. I've decided just to re-share them.

Had same issue. Portrait mode photos showed up grey to others in shared album. Everyone updated to 15.2.1 however all shared photo albums with portrait mode photos remained greyed out. Tried rebooting, log out and login for iCloud and iPhotos - still grey. I had to reupload all the portrait photos and now they show up in shared albums for others. Pretty sloppy bug, Apple…
